Cheshmeh-ye Asī
Cheshmeh-ye Asī is a spring in Fars, Central Iran and has an elevation of 2,319 metres. Cheshmeh-ye Asī is situated nearby to the locality Chāh Gūrāz Gūn, as well as near the area Chāh-e Tangazī.| Tap on a place to explore it |
